Catalister FAQ
Catalister is offered exclusively as a SaaS platform and does not currently support self-hosting. All data and processing occur on their managed cloud infrastructure to ensure seamless updates and scaling.

No, Catalister requires an active internet connection to access its cloud-based dashboard and automation features. There is no offline mode or local client available at this time.

Users retain full ownership of their Amazon listing and catalog data uploaded to Catalister. The platform provides export tools to download your data in standard formats, facilitating migration or backups.

Catalister offers a REST API with rate limits varying by subscription tier. Some advanced endpoints are restricted to higher plans, and bulk operation support is limited to prevent overload. Detailed API documentation outlines these constraints.

Migrating from Feedvisor to Catalister involves exporting your existing catalog data and reconfiguring automation workflows in Catalister. While no direct import tool exists, the platform’s onboarding team provides support to streamline this transition, though some manual effort is expected.

Hector AI FAQ
Hector AI is offered exclusively as a SaaS platform and does not currently support self-hosting. All data processing and optimization algorithms run on their cloud infrastructure, which means you cannot deploy or manage Hector AI on your own servers.

Hector AI requires an active internet connection to access its cloud-based services and update ad campaign data in real time. There is no offline mode or local caching available, as optimization relies on continuous data syncing with Amazon Ads APIs.

Campaign data managed via Hector AI remains the property of the user, but is stored and processed on Hector AI's cloud servers. The platform complies with standard data privacy regulations but does not currently offer on-premise data storage or encryption keys controlled by the customer.

Hector AI uses Amazon's official Ads API and adheres to Amazon's rate limits and quota restrictions. Additionally, Hector AI imposes its own API usage limits depending on the subscription tier, which can affect the frequency of automated optimizations and data syncs.

Hector AI offers CSV import/export functionality to facilitate migration from other PPC platforms. However, automated migration tools are limited, so teams often need to manually map campaign structures and historical data. The migration effort can vary based on the complexity of existing campaigns.
